The first Prophecy in the Bible pointing toward Jesus is found in Genesis 3:15, at the fall of mankind. God said to the serpent, “And I will put enmity between thee and the woman, and between thy seed and her seed; it shall bruise thy head, and thou shalt bruise his heel.” Women don’t have seeds, they have eggs! This Prophecy points to the Virgin Birth, the way back to God, Jesus Christ! Where are we in Bible Prophecy?

Jesus said He would go away, but that He would return again. He said, in the meantime His presence with us would be manifested through the Holy Spirit! Jesus said, “And now I have told you before it come to pass, that, when it is come to pass, ye might believe” (John 14:29). Jesus fulfilled numerous Old Testament Prophecies leading up to, during, and after His first coming! And Jesus, as well as the Apostles, spoke of, and explained numerous Prophecies about what to expect leading up to, during, and after His second coming. His first coming was marked at the Triumphal Entry during the 69th week of “Daniel’s 70 weeks”. And so the Church Age began! Paul described the temporary transition this way, “For I would not, brethren, that ye should be ignorant of this mystery, lest ye should be wise in your own conceits; that blindness in part is happened to Israel, until the fulness of the Gentiles be come in” (Romans 11:25). The fullness of the Gentiles will come in at the Second Coming of Christ! Then Jesus will establish His Millennial Reign! One thousand years with a government that makes sense! And then eternity in Heaven! But before the Millennial Reign, the Tribulation, and before the Tribulation, the Church will be Raptured in the twinkling of an eye to meet Him in the air! So, where are we in Bible Prophecy?

We’re still in the Church age now but, the last and seventieth week of “Daniel’s 70 weeks” is obviously about to resume with the seven-year Tribulation! If so, that would mean the Rapture is imminent! The rebirth of Israel, Ezekiel 36-37, took place in 1948 against all odds! Zechariah 12:3 says, “And in that day will I make Jerusalem a burdensome stone for all people: all that burden themselves with it shall be cut in pieces, though all the people of the earth be gathered together against it.” Friends, Jerusalem is a burdensome stone in the eyes of the world today, and the Tribulation hasn’t even begun yet!

Russia, Turkey, and Iran are in Syria directly north of Israel! The complete and total destruction of Damascus Syria as described in Isaiah 17 is a major probability. The War of Gog and Magog against Israel (Ezekiel 38-39) is lining up geopolitically as it should according to the Prophecy! Not to be confused with Armageddon, scholars believe the Ezekiel 38-39 War will likely take place at or just after the Rapture. The Rapture is imminent because the Tribulation is near!
